Debridement
A medical procedure involving the removal of dead, damaged, or infected tissue to promote healing.
Lacerated Tissue
Tissue that has been torn or deeply cut, often seen in wounds that might require surgical repair.
Contaminated Tissue
Biological tissue that has been exposed to pathogens, chemicals, or radioactivity, posing a risk of infection or harm.
